In electronics manufacturing, integrated circuit assembly is the final stage of semiconductor device fabrication, in which the tiny block of semiconducting material is encased in a supporting case that prevents physical damage and corrosion. The case, known as a "package", supports the electrical contacts which connect the device to a circuit board. Once the final "front-end" processes are complete, final device testing is done to verify that electronic performance is satisfactory. Less
